From: GF-1 WFV satellite images based forest cover mapping in China supported by open land use/cover datasets

Fig. 4

The detail of FCM16. (a,b) are the map and the local statistical accuracy of the FCM16 respectively. (cg) represent the high-resolution satellite maps and the FCM16 for the five sites (cf) in sub-image (a) respectively. Site (c) is located in the densely forested distribution area in south China; site (d) is located in the Sichuan basin, where forests are small and interspersed with farmland; site (e) is located in the transition area of the Loess Plateau, where vast ecological protection forests have been planted; the site (f) locates in the Northeast, where a large number of planted forests are distributed; and the site (g) locates in the Altai Mountains, where the forests are relatively homogeneous and dominated by coniferous forests.
